P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: (Erledigt)Sharp GP2Y0A02 @ 3,5V



tdomega
21.03.2006, 01:08
HiHo,

Ich hab jetzt auch endlich angefangen rumzubasteln, und schon werfen sich mir die Steine in den Weg.

Ich habe das RN-Control-32. TestProgramm läuft wunderbar. Jetzt hab ich grade den Sharp GP2Y0A02YK angeschlossen wie in dem bil Anschlussbeispiel gezeigt. (5V/Gnd über JP8 entnommen & SensorSpannung in Port A gesteckt)

Der Sharp bekommt Strom, 5V ziemlich genau. Wenn ich reinschaue seh ich auch das die LED leuchtet.
Mit dem Testprogramm wollte ich mir nun alle Messwerte von Port A anzeigen lassen, jedoch gibt mir hier dort wo der Sensor eingesteckt ist das Programm stets 3,435V zurück. Immer.
mal davon abgesehen das eine so hohe Spannung doch garnicht zulässig ist (ca 0,25 bis 2,85) ändert sich diese auch nicht egal wie weit der Sensor von meinem weißen Blatt Papier entfernt ist...
Sonst hängt nix an dem Board, ausser der RS232-Stecker.

Ist der Sensor kaput? -Ist gestern erst mit der Post gekommen :(

Bin für jeden Ratschlag offen...

[Edit]
Hmmm, wenn ich V0 vom Sensor an Port 6 hänge, und dann Batteriespannungsabfrage mache, dann bekomm ich unterschiedliche Werte die auch einigermaßen zu passen scheinen, aber an den anderen Ports Fehlanzeige...

Ich benutze diesen Code um mir die Apannung auszugeben


For I = 0 To 25
Start Adc
Ws = Getadc(3)
Volt = Ws * Ref

Print "Pin 3 ADC-Wert=" ; Ws ; " --> " ; Volt ; " Volt"
Stop Adc
Waitms 100
Next I


[Edit²]
Hat sich erledigt, bin auf ein Posting gestoßen wo erwähnt wurde das man bei diesem Sensor den entsprechenden Pullupwiderstand deaktivieren muss. Ist dies getan funzt alles so wie es soll einwandfrei :)